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t vs Boiled Lupins with Salt: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t has 1.3 times more Vitamin B3, 2.1 times more Vitamin B5, 10.3 times more Vitamin B6 and 2.4 times more Vitamin B9 than Boiled Lupins with Salt.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Lupins with Salt contains 2.3 times more Vitamin B2 than Boiled Mothbeans with Salt.
- Both Boiled Mothbeans with Salt and Boiled Lupins with Salt provide similar amounts of Vitamin B1 per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B2
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Lupins with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B6
- Both Boiled Mothbeans with Salt as well as Boiled Lupins with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C and Vitamin D in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Boiled Mothbeans with Salt vs Boiled Lupins with Salt: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t has 2.6 times more Iron, 1.9 times more Magnesium and 1.2 times more Potassium than Boiled Lupins with Salt.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Lupins with Salt contains 17 times more Calcium, 1.4 times more Copper, 1.3 times more Manganese and 2.3 times more Zinc than Boiled Mothbeans with Salt.
- Both Boiled Mothbeans with Salt and Boiled Lupins with Salt contain similar levels of Phosphorus, Selenium and Sodium per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Mothbeans with Salt has 2.3 times more Carbohydrate than Boiled Lupins with Salt.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Lupins with Salt contains 5.3 times more Fat, 1.5 times more Omega 3, 3.6 times more Omega 6 and 2 times more Protein than Boiled Mothbeans with Salt.
- Both Boiled Mothbeans with Salt and Boiled Lupins with Salt offer comparable quantities of Energy per one kilogram.
